Relax and Rejuvenate in Podčetrtek: Slovenia’s Spa Haven
Nestled in the gentle hills of eastern Slovenia, Podčetrtek is a municipality known for its lush landscapes, thermal springs, and tranquil ambiance. The region is famed for Terme Olimia, one of Slovenia’s premier wellness resorts, drawing visitors seeking relaxation and rejuvenation. Picturesque villages, vineyards, and forests surround the area, offering a peaceful escape from urban life. Podčetrtek’s charm also lies in its blend of natural beauty and rich cultural heritage. The imposing Olimje Monastery, with its ancient pharmacy, stands as a testament to the region’s historical significance.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y hiking, cycling, and exploring the Sotla River valley, while families find fun at the local adventure parks and thermal complexes. Podčetrtek is a perfect destination for those seeking wellness, nature, and a taste of Slovenian countryside hospitality.
Safety
Podčetrtek is a safe and welcoming destination with low crime rates. Standard precautions are sufficient, and the area is well-patrolled, especially around major resorts and tourist attractions.
Visas
As part of Slovenia, Schengen Area visa rules apply. EU/EEA citizens can enter freely, while others may require a visa.
Customs regulations
Greet locals with a friendly 'Dober dan' (Good day). Modesty in dress is appreciated in religious sites like the Olimje Monastery. Tipping is customary but not obligatory—rounding up the bill is sufficient.
Prices
Podčetrtek is moderately priced compared to Western Europe. Accommodation ranges from budget guesthouses to luxury spa hotels, with meals and activities offering good value.
People and nationalities
The population is predominantly Slovene, and locals are known for their hospitality and strong ties to traditional customs. The community is family-oriented, with many engaged in agriculture, winemaking, and wellness tourism.
Weather
Podčetrtek experiences a temperate continental climate with warm summers and cold winters. The best time to visit is from late spring to early autumn (May–September), when temperatures are pleasant and the countryside is vibrant. Winters can be chilly but are ideal for enjoying the region’s thermal spas.
Health
Podčetrtek has access to local medical clinics and pharmacies, with more comprehensive hospitals located in nearby Celje. Tap water is safe to drink throughout the region.
Food
Gobova juha
A traditional mushroom soup made with locally foraged mushrooms, potatoes, and herbs, often served as a starter in countryside inns.
Pohorski pisker
A hearty stew combining pork, beef, sauerkraut, potatoes, and spices, reflecting the region’s rustic culinary traditions.
Olimje honey treats
Sweet delicacies made from local honey, produced by beekeepers near the Olimje Monastery, often featured in desserts and pastries.
Buckwheat žganci
A simple side dish of buckwheat spoonbread, typically served with sour milk or as an accompaniment to stews and meats.
Kozjanski štruklji
Rolled dumplings filled with cottage cheese and herbs, a specialty from the Kozjansko hills surrounding Podčetrtek.
Transport
Local Bus Service
Podčetrtek is connected by regional buses to nearby towns and cities, including Celje and Rogaška Slatina.
Train to Podčetrtek Station
Trains from Celje and other major Slovenian cities stop at Podčetrtek, offering convenient access to the municipality.
Car Rental
Renting a car is the most flexible way to explore Podčetrtek and the surrounding countryside, with good road connections and ample parking.
Bicycle Hire
Many hotels and resorts offer bicycle rentals, making it easy to explore the gentle hills and local villages at your own pace.

Activities
Relax at Terme Olimia
Unwind in thermal pools, wellness centers, and massage rooms at one of Slovenia’s best-known spa resorts.
Visit Olimje Monastery
Tour the beautiful baroque monastery, its historic pharmacy, and the adjacent chocolate shop.
Hiking in Kozjansko Regional Park
Explore scenic trails through rolling hills, wildflower meadows, and forests in the protected Kozjansko Park.
Family Fun at Aqualuna Water Park
Enjoy a day of slides and pools at the family-friendly Aqualuna, connected to the Terme Olimia complex.
Wine Tasting in Local Vineyards
Sample regional wines in Podčetrtek’s picturesque wine cellars and vineyards overlooking the Sotla valley.
